文档章节

hibernate.cfg.xml 配置

春泥村雨
 春泥村雨
发布于 2017/07/23 16:37
字数 182
阅读 1
收藏 0
<!-- Hibernate 版本:hibernate-release-5.2.10.Final -->

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E hibernate-configuration PUBLIC
		"-//Hibernate/Hibernate Configuration DTD 3.0//EN"
		"http://www.hibernate.org/dtd/hibernate-configuration-3.0.dtd">
<hibernate-configuration>
    <session-factory>
        <!-- 数据库驱动 -->
        <property name="hibernate.connection.driver_class">com.mysql.jdbc.Driver</property>
        <!-- 数据库连接 -->
        <property name="hibernate.connection.url">
            jdbc:mysql://localhost:3306/test?useUnicode=true&amp;characterEncoding=utf8
            <!-- jdbc:mysql:///test?useUnicode=true&amp;characterEncoding=utf8 -->
        </property>
        <!-- 数据库用户名 -->
        <property name="hibernate.connection.username">root</property>
        <!-- 数据库密码 -->
        <property name="hibernate.connection.password">root</property>
        <!-- 数据库方言 -->
        <property name="hibernate.dialect">org.hibernate.dialect.MySQL5InnoDBDialect</property>
        <!-- 显示SQL -->
        <property name="show_sql">true</property>
        <!-- 数据库建表方式 -->
        <property name="hbm2ddl.auto">update</property>
		<!-- 使用getCurrentSession方式打开会话 -->
		<property name="hibernate.current_session_context_class">thread</property>
        <!-- 类与表的映射关系,用XML文件方式配置 -->
        <!-- 
        <mapping resource="com/imooc/entity/Student.hbm.xml"/> 
        <mapping resource="com/imooc/entity/Grade.hbm.xml"/>
        -->
        <!-- 类与表的映射关系,类中用注解方式配置 -->
        <mapping class="com.bjsxt.entity.User" />
    </session-factory>
</hibernate-configuration>

© 著作权归作者所有

共有 人打赏支持
春泥村雨
粉丝 0
博文 8
码字总数 1794
作品 0
太原
程序员
私信 提问
hibernate学习笔记02-- eclipse 下 hibernate+mysql 的实现。

hibernate 环境的配置步骤: 加入 hibernate 所需的 jar 包,并将这些 jar 添加到 project 中,如图: hibernate.cfg.xml 的建立。hibernate 的 hibernate.cfg.xml 配置文件默认在 project/...

风中海岸
2015/08/29
0
0
求javaweb方向的前辈们,关于三大框架中配置文件的一些疑问~很急

我在进行ssh整合的时候有时候数据库的连接池信息和实体类的映射怎么都可以配置在spring的配置文件里面?有时候甚至都不需要hibernate.cfg.xml这个配置文件,难道spring已经完全把hibernate融...

上帝爱众生
2015/03/19
383
0
Spring对hibernate配置文件hibernate.cfg.xml的集成,来取代hibern

Spring对hibernate配置文件hibernate.cfg.xml的集成,来取代hibernate.cfg.xml的配置 spring对hibernate配置文件hibernate.cfg.xml的集成相当好,可以在Spring中配置Hibernate的SessionFact...

我的小确幸日记
2016/05/10
240
1
Hibernate整合Spring后,如何使用SchemaExport生成数据库表

SchemaExport生成数据库表 一.Hibernate原生状态 Configuration cfg = new Configuration().configure(); SchemaExport export = new SchemaExport(cfg); export.create(true, true); 二.H......

非作者
2012/08/18
0
1
spring整合hibernate配置文件

Spring对hibernate配置文件hibernate.cfg.xml的集成,来取代hibernate.cfg.xml的配置 spring对hibernate配置文件hibernate.cfg.xml的集成相当好,可以在Spring中配置Hibernate的SessionFact...

lovedreamland
2014/04/01
0
0

没有更多内容

加载失败,请刷新页面

加载更多

windows下让 jar 在后台运行的办法

windows下 运行 java jar 不出现 命令行 窗口 新建一个披处理 run.bat,内容如下 @echo off start javaw -jar xx.jar exit 双击运行即可。...

glen_xu
12分钟前
1
0
jdk1.8 lambda stream 指定的对象属性进行去重

原因:因为Stream提供的distinct()方法只能去除重复的对象,无法根据指定的对象属性进行去重,可以应付简单场景。 解决方案: //去重,共同信息保存到bizPledgeSupplierVOs里bizPledgeSupp...

INSISTQIAO
15分钟前
0
0
vue nextTick深入理解---vue性能优化、DOM更新时机、事件循环机制

定义[nextTick、事件循环] nextTick的由来: 由于vue的数据驱动视图更新是异步的,即修改数据的当下,视图不会立即更新,而是等同一事件循环中的所有数据变化完成之后再统一进行视图更新。...

JamesView
23分钟前
1
0
常用汉字编码

GB2312 仅包含大部分的常用简体汉字,但已经不能适应现在的需要; GB13000 由于GB2312的局限性,国家标准化委员会制定了GB13000编码; 但由于当时的硬件和软件都已经支持了GB2312,而GB13000...

晨猫
25分钟前
1
0
纳尼?我的Gradle build编译只要1s

https://juejin.im/post/5c00ec39e51d4555ec0394f6

SuShine
26分钟前
6
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部